If not, see . # # The original `Config` design model is unproudly borrowed from # the rough pypy's guys: http://codespeak.net/svn/pypy/dist/pypy/config/ # the whole pypy projet is under MIT licence # ____________________________________________________________ from typing import Any from ..setting import undefined, OptionBag from ..i18n import _ from .option import Option from ..autolib import Calculation from ..error import ConfigError, display_list class ChoiceOption(Option): """represents a choice out of several objects. The option can also have the value ``None`` """ __slots__ = tuple() _type = 'choice' _display_name = _('choice') def __init__(self, name, doc, values, *args, **kwargs): """ :param values: is a list of values the option can possibly take """ if not isinstance(values, (Calculation, tuple)): raise TypeError(_('values must be a tuple or a calculation for {0}' ).format(name)) self._choice_values = values super().__init__(name, doc, *args, **kwargs) async def impl_get_values(self, option_bag): if isinstance(self._choice_values, Calculation): values = await self._choice_values.execute(option_bag) if values is not undefined and not isinstance(values, list): raise ConfigError(_('calculated values for {0} is not a list' '').format(self.impl_getname())) else: values = self._choice_values return values def validate(self, value: Any) -> None: pass def sync_validate_with_option(self, value: Any, option_bag: OptionBag) -> None: if isinstance(self._choice_values, Calculation): return values = self._choice_values self.validate_values(value, values) async def validate_with_option(self, value: Any, option_bag: OptionBag) -> None: values = await self.impl_get_values(option_bag) self.validate_values(value, values) def validate_values(self, value, values, ) -> None: if values is not undefined and value not in values: if len(values) == 1: raise ValueError(_('only "{0}" is allowed' '').format(values[0])) raise ValueError(_('only {0} are allowed' '').format(display_list(values, add_quote=True)))
